3.1 Where Clause

The format of where clause is like

Where<conditions>

Theconditionsare composed of one or more conditional statements, there exist three types of condition statements

  • Numeric comparison

  • String equality comparison

  • Logical operator

3.1.1 Numeric comparison

The numeric comparison should support 6 operators and with two data types

Operators:

  • =equal to

  • !=not equal to

  • >greater

  • <less

  • >=greater or equal to

  • <=less or equal to Data types:

  • Integer

  • Floating point number

    • Please usedouble data type in C langto do the operation

Example:

Table content:

ID

Name

email

age

1

user1

user1@example.com

20

2

user2

user2@example.com

21

db > select * from table where age=20

The select result will be the following:

(1, “user1”, “user1@example.com“,20)

3.2 Aggregation Functions

Implement the following aggregation to aggregate data

  • avg — the average of an expression in a SELECT statement and satisfying the criteria specified in the WHERE clause

    • Usingdoubleto do the operations, and accurate to only the third digit after the decimal point.

  • count — the number of rows in a table satisfying the criteria specified in the WHERE clause

  • sum — the sum of an expression in a SELECT statement and satisfying the criteria specified in the WHERE clause

Example:

Table content:

ID

Name

email

age

1

user1

user1@example.com

20

2

user2

user2@example.com

21

3

user3

user3@example.com

22

4

user4

user4@example.com

23

If we execute the following command

db > select sum(age) from table where age>20 db > select avg(age) from table where age>20

The result will be the following because we sum up and average age which rows are satisfied age is larger than 20.

(66)

(22.000)

Note:Where is optional in the aggregation function. If no where clause is provided, all corresponding data will be included.
